Problem is my car was in a bad state to start with, so I did lots of stuff you probably didn't. However, I'm also trying to do everything, so that it looks as if it was standard fitment.
I'm running the standard 4AGZE flywheel, and the starter that came with the engine when I bought it, works with the bell I bought for the box. Also, I've read a few articles that suggest that the 4A range don't run evenly at idling, and that a lighter flywheel worsens it. The GZE flywheel is slightly heavier than the GE's, and I recon it's pressure plate is also a little beafier, so no need to upgrade to aftermarket stuff. Did get a copper plate though.
